
verb (used with or without object), an·thro·po·mor·phized, an·thro·po·mor·phiz·ing.
- to ascribe human form or attributes to (an animal, plant, material object, etc.).
verb
- to attribute or ascribe human form or behaviour to (a god, animal, object, etc)
1834; see anthropomorphic + -ize. Related: Anthropomorphized; anthopomorphizing.
